I wanted to mention that I agree with ROGER CRAVENS. I am a director of
the Chicago Area Radio Monitoring Association (CARMA), and we used to be
known for many years as "RCMA - Chicago Chapter."  We were more or less
told by Anaheim that we had to "disassociate our name," but could be
affiliated with RCMA. That only made our local organization stronger. We
have over 500 members, meet every other month at various locations in
metro Chicago, publish and excellent newsletter and have a fine BBS.
At our CARMA meeting this last Saturday, Rich Carlson N9JIG, also
director of CARMA and author of SCANNER MASTER, Illinois Communications
Guide made similar statements as Mr. Cravens.  I am inclined that if
everyone took this position, then US Scanner and RCMA could solidify the
national organization(s) for scanner hobbyists.
